Technically you're out of the Forest and in Dorset once you arrive in Christchurch, but we won't hold that against them. There's a healthy dose of history with what's apparently the oldest church in the country, but the real draw are the sandy beaches and quayside with its picture-perfect beach huts and crab shacks serving freshly caught seafood.

A quick ferry ride away from Lymington, a trip to the Isle of Wight is a lovely way to spend a day. From Yarmouth where the ferry docks, you can jump on a bus to explore the rest of island. We often eat at On The Rocks, which is just a few steps away from the quayside, before getting one of the last boats back.

In the nearest enclosure to our house, you'll often spot deer hiding in the trees, but if you want to (almost!) guarantee a whole herd of them, then you're best off heading to the Bolderwood Deer Sanctuary, where there's a special viewing platform over a large meadow and the keepers feed the deer daily between April and September.
